"The Elephant Man" comes to The Beverly Theater for a special screening of this acclaimed cinematic masterpiece. This 1980 film, directed by David Lynch, tells the poignant true story of John Merrick, a severely deformed man in Victorian London who goes from a life as a circus sideshow attraction to becoming the toast of London society.
The film, starring John Hurt and Anthony Hopkins, is renowned for its striking black-and-white cinematography and powerful performances that earned it eight Academy Award nominations.
